WebDyslexia refers to a cluster of symptoms, which result in people having difficulties with specific language skills, particularly reading. Students with dyslexia usually experience … WebProper, professional dyslexia testing typically involves three elements: 1) An interview with the parent (s) to establish that a reading problem exists, and to review family history. You may be asked to bring report cards, previous assessments or standardized test results and samples of your child's written work. WebNov 4, 2024 · Rather, a series of reading tests, along with observations from parents and teachers, are considered. Dyslexia testing involves four components: phonological awareness, decoding, reading fluency ... WebManaging dyslexia symptoms includes aids like tinted dyslexia glasses and dyslexia fonts. It also includes behavioral coping strategies at school such as putting dyslexic children at the front of the class, a reader/writer for tests and of course, it includes using tutors. These strategies do not address the underlying difficulty.
